CNRL Bridge Put-In
Wood Buffalo, Alberta, Canada
CNRL Bridge Put-In is located in the Wood Buffalo area of Alberta, Canada, near coordinates 57.21096, -111.68880. This Class 1 paddling location serves as a convenient access point for river paddlers in the region.
The put-in features a play spot, making it suitable for paddlers interested in practicing maneuvers and technical skills.
